The Current Market Value of the Refrigeration Industry

As of 2023, the refrigeration industry is estimated to be worth over $200 billion globally. This figure accounts for various segments within the industry, including residential, commercial, and industrial refrigeration systems. The continuous growth of the industry can be attributed to several factors, making it a pivotal part of the global economy.

Key Segments Within the Refrigeration Industry

To understand the overall worth of the refrigeration industry, it’s essential to break it down into its key segments. Each segment contributes significantly to the total market value.

1. Residential Refrigeration

The residential refrigeration segment encompasses household appliances such as refrigerators and freezers. This segment is witnessing steady demand driven by:

  • Population Growth and Urbanization: As more people move to urban areas, the demand for residential refrigeration appliances increases, fueling market growth.
  • Increasing Disposable Income: More disposable income allows consumers to invest in advanced refrigeration technologies that enhance energy efficiency and food preservation.

2. Commercial Refrigeration

Commercial refrigeration serves businesses in the retail, foodservice, and hospitality sectors. This segment includes walk-in coolers, display refrigerators, and more. Key factors influencing its worth include:

  • Food Safety Regulations: Stricter regulations demand better refrigeration solutions, propelling businesses to invest in high-quality cooling systems.
  • Expansion of Retail and Foodservice Industries: The rise of grocery stores, restaurants, and convenience stores drives commercial refrigeration demand.

3. Industrial Refrigeration

Industrial refrigeration is vital for maintaining temperature-sensitive processes in sectors such as chemical manufacturing, pharmaceuticals, and cold storage. It accounts for a significant portion of the refrigeration industry’s overall value due to:

  • Technological Advancements: Innovations such as eco-friendly refrigerants and automation enhance efficiency and performance in industrial cooling solutions.
  • Global Supply Chain Growth: The increased focus on supply chain efficiency and logistics requires sophisticated refrigeration systems to maintain product quality.

Future Trends Shaping the Refrigeration Industry

As we look to the future, several trends are poised to shape the refrigeration industry significantly:

1. Shift Towards Natural Refrigerants

In response to environmental regulations and consumer preferences for sustainability, there is a growing shift towards natural refrigerants, such as ammonia and CO2. These options have minimal environmental impact compared to traditional refrigerants.

2. Smart Refrigeration Solutions

The future of refrigeration will increasingly involve smart technology, allowing for real-time data monitoring and management. These smart systems improve operational efficiency while reducing energy consumption, making them viable options for both businesses and consumers.

3. Increased Focus on Food Safety

Food safety will remain a critical concern in the coming years. Enhanced refrigeration technologies will be vital in ensuring that food products are stored safely and effectively, especially in light of rising foodborne illnesses and safety regulations.

How does refrigeration affect food safety?

Refrigeration is a key factor in ensuring food safety by inhibiting the growth of bacteria and pathogens that can lead to foodborne illnesses. By maintaining proper temperature controls throughout storage and transport, refrigeration systems help prevent spoilage and contamination, significantly reducing health risks associated with consuming perishable food items. This is critical not just for consumer safety but also to maintain public health standards.

In addition to preserving food quality, refrigeration also plays a vital role in the supply chain’s integrity. Effective refrigeration practices ensure that food products remain fresh from farm to table, thereby contributing to customer trust in food manufacturers and suppliers. Adhering to stringent refrigeration practices is necessary to meet health regulations and ensure that consumers are provided with safe, high-quality food.
